libstdc++: Fix std::deque::emplace calling wrong _M_insert_aux [PR90389]

We have several overloads of std::deque::_M_insert_aux, one of which is
variadic and called by std::deque::emplace. With a suitable set of
arguments to emplace, it's possible for one of the non-variadic
_M_insert_aux overloads to be selected by overload resolution, making
emplace ill-formed.

Rename the variadic _M_insert_aux to _M_emplace_aux so that calls to
emplace never select an _M_insert_aux overload. Also add an inline
_M_insert_aux for the const lvalue overload that is called from
insert(const_iterator, const value_type&).

libstdc++-v3/ChangeLog:

	PR libstdc++/90389
	* include/bits/deque.tcc (_M_insert_aux): Rename variadic
	overload to _M_emplace_aux.
	* include/bits/stl_deque.h (_M_insert_aux): Define inline.
	(_M_emplace_aux): Declare.
	* testsuite/23_containers/deque/modifiers/emplace/90389.cc: New
	test.
